US restricts travel from southern Africa due to new omicron COVID-19 variant 

The U.S. will limit travel from South Africa and several other countries in that region due to the troubling new COVID-19 variant, omicron. The new restrictions  apply to travelers from South Africa, Botswana, Zimbabwe, Namibia, Lesotho, Eswatini, Mozambique and Malawi. U.S. citizens and lawful permanent residents are excluded. The policy was implemented out of an "abundance of caution'' in light of the new variant, which the World Health Organization declared a variant of concern Friday. Despite the global worry, scientists cautioned that it's still unclear whether omicron is more dangerous than other versions of the virus that has killed more than 5 million people.

Ghislaine Maxwell's accusers say she sexually exploited them. Here's what her trial may reveal.

Opening arguments will begin Monday in the federal sex-trafficking trial of Ghislaine Maxwell, who is charged with helping her long-time companion, financier Jeffrey Epstein, recruit, groom and exploit girls as young as 14 years old for sexual abuse. The alleged incidents ran from 1994 to 2004, in locations including an Upper East Side residence in New York; an estate in Palm Beach, Florida; a ranch in Santa Fe, New Mexico; and a residence in London. The question for the jury will be whether Maxwell procured underage girls for Epstein knowing he would abuse them. Maxwell has denied all charges.

Oklahoma searches for coach following Lincoln Riley's move to USC

The University of Oklahoma will resume its search for a new head football coach Monday after Lincoln Riley left to take the same position at USC . "Leaving OU was probably the most difficult decision of my life," Riley said in a statement released by Oklahoma on Sunday. "OU is one of the best college football programs in the country, and it has been forever. That's not going to change." As the head coach at Oklahoma, Riley had a 55-10 record and led the Sooners to four Big 12 titles and three appearances in the College Football Playoff. USC is hiring Riley amidst a 4-7 season and after it fired former coach Clay Helton two games into the campaign.

Trial starts for Jussie Smollett on charges of staging 2019 hate crime attack

In January 2019, Jussie Smollett, a Black and openly gay actor, reported to Chicago police that he was the victim of a hate crime. Nearly three years later, Smollett is about to stand trial  on charges that he staged the whole thing. Smollett was charged with staging the attack to further his career and secure a higher salary. And, police said, he hired two brothers from Nigeria to pretend to attack him for $3,500. Key witnesses will be the brothers, Abimbola and Olabinjo Osundairo, who say Smollett wrote them a check to stage the attack.  Jury selection is scheduled to begin Monday, and Smollett has pleaded not guilty.
